<p>PURPOSE:To reduce the cost of an analyzing instruments and to improve the reliability thereof by detecting the concn. of O2 and CO2 in a waste combustion gas, incorporating the detected concn. values into the specific equation and determining the concn. of N2 and the concn. of H2O by computation. CONSTITUTION:Fuel is burned in a combustion furnace and the waste gas is supplied to an O2 concn. detector and CO2 concn. detector, by which the concns. thereof are detected. The O2 concn. value and CO2 concn. value obtd. by the detectors are substd. into the equation I, the equation II (where (a) and (b) are the values of CO2 and H2 in the waste combustion gas during combustion by the supply of theoretical air amt. for each 1kg of the fuel, m<3>/kg). The concn. of N2 and the concn. of H2O are determined by the arithmetic processing. The concns. of the O2, CO2, N2 and H2O are respectively displayed on a display part. The concns. of the O2 and CO2 in the waste combustion gas are thus detected and the concns. of the N2 and H2O are determined by using such detected values and therefore there is no need for providing an N2 concn. detecting part and H2O concn. detecting part and the cost of the instrument is reduced.</p> |
